Output e90dd928ab37fe88ad382229ee070ebb970e32f256e789ff684a51aab5205b87:1

value
338921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85437838024fcd28603155316d3a82dc4b817ff6 OP_EQUAL
address
3DqecvkQcVwKa2AaBnZBYAqeixBxJXXnWb
transaction
e90dd928ab37fe88ad382229ee070ebb970e32f256e789ff684a51aab5205b87
spent
true